Cultural References
Penthouse apartments are considered to be at the top of their markets, and are generally the most expensive, with expansive views, large living spaces, and top-of-the line amenities. Accordingly, they are often associated with a luxury lifestyle. Publisher Bob Guccione named his magazine Penthouse, with the trademark phrase "Life on top".
Those wishing to market or otherwise inflate the prestige of a particular apartment may use the term. The term penthouse is sometimes applied to apartments that are no different than others in a building, other than being on one of the uppermost floors. The terms sub-penthouse or lower penthouse are used to describe apartments below the top of a building, when the term penthouse or upper penthouse is reserved for the uppermost floor.
